파이썬

[Python] with as 구문

PGNV 2021. 10. 5. 16:20

with as 사용 이유

프로그램 짤때 코드가 길어지는 경우 파일이나 특정 함수를 열고 닫아야지 충돌없이 잘 작동함

But 프로그램 짜다보면 닫는걸 까먹거나 찾기 어려운 상황에 사용하는게 with as 구문

※with as는 파일, 특정 함수를 열고 -> 쓰고 -> 닫고 알아서 자동으로 함

 

with open('test.txt', 'r') as tt:
	test_file = tt.read()
    print(test.file)

test.txt 라는 파일이 있을때, with as 구문으로 열어본다.

open을 사용했으면, 반드시 마지막에 close()을 사용해야함

'파이썬' 카테고리의 다른 글

아스키 코드 표 (ASCII Code)  (0) 2021.06.22
파이썬 대표적인 에러 종류  (0) 2021.06.15
파이썬 파일의 열기 모드  (0) 2021.06.15
import , import as, from import, from import * 의 차이  (0) 2021.06.09
스택(Stack)  (0) 2021.05.18